#7e85c2 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#7e85c2 is composed of 49.4% red, 52.2% green and 76.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 35.1% cyan, 31.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 23.9% black. It has a hue angle of 233.8 degrees, a saturation of 35.8% and a lightness of 62.7%. #7e85c2 color hex could be obtained by blending #fcffff with #000b85. Closest websafe color is: #6699cc.

● #7e85c2 color description : Slightly desaturated blue.
The hexadecimal color #7e85c2 has RGB values of R:126, G:133, B:194 and CMYK values of C:0.35, M:0.31, Y:0, K:0.24. Its decimal value is 8291778.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020204 is the darkest color, while #f6f6fb is the lightest one.
